When you stay at Ariana Sustainable Luxury Lodge - Special Class in Nevşehir, you'll be in a national park, just steps from Göreme National Park and 8 minutes by foot from Uchisar Castle. This luxury hotel is 3 mi (4.7 km) from Goreme Open Air Museum and 6.7 mi (10.8 km) from Red Valley. Make yourself at home in one of the 11 individually decorated guestrooms, featuring iPod docking stations and minibars. Your bed comes with down comforters and Egyptian cotton sheets. Wired and wireless internet access is complimentary, while 42-inch LED televisions with satellite programming provide entertainment. Bathrooms with shower/tub combinations feature deep soaking bathtubs and designer toiletries. Featured amenities include a business center, express check-in, and complimentary newspapers in the lobby. A roundtrip airport shuttle is provided for a surcharge (available 24 hours), and free valet parking is available onsite.
